上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 20 下一页
  2012年1月5日
摘要: 转自:http://www.riameeting.com/node/979相信只要开发过Flex应用程序的读者都已经使用过数据绑定(Data Binding),数据绑定是Flex非常重要的特性之一,它就像一种魔法一样,能快速让你将应用程序中两个不同的部份通过数据绑定联系起来,大大提高了 开发的效率,这也是让Flex如此流行的特性之一。大多时候我们并不需要了解数据绑定背后的机制,然而,随着在Flex应用程序规模不断增大,数据绑定特 性也被开发人员使用得越来越多,其带来的问题也逐渐显现出来,正因为它像魔法一样,使用起来非常简单,因而很多开发人员并未去深入了解数据绑定背后的工作 机制,致使在应用中使 阅读全文
posted @ 2012-01-05 11:39 星^_^風 阅读(149) 评论(0) 推荐(0) 编辑
摘要: 在flex中,Event是一个比较神奇,而且是我们必须经常打交道的一个类,黑羽大哥的一句话很经典:平生不识Event,就称闪客也枉然,说明了Event在Flash和Flex中的地位。那么这个非常重要的东西,该如何去应用呢?在这之前,我们要清楚一个事情,那就是Event是Object这个伟大父亲的220多个孩子之一,也就是说,它是直接继承于Object的。可是我们知道这有什么用处呢,嘿~,用处大啦,因为这代表了Event的贵族气质,即:在Event中,级别高的控件触发的事件,在级别低的控件中是无法被监听到的,怎么样,够高傲了吧。到了这里,有人会说,这有点扯了吧,只从这个就能看出这点吗?答案当然不 阅读全文
posted @ 2012-01-05 09:23 星^_^風 阅读(217) 评论(0) 推荐(0) 编辑
  2012年1月4日
摘要: 一.首先下载安装Eclipse 3.0以上版本解压到 D:\Program Files\eclipse 到算安装成功了.二.下载安装Flex Builder 3.0http://trials.adobe.com/Applications/Flex/FlexBuilder/3/FB3_WWEJ_Plugin.exe1. 指定把 Flex Builder 3.0安装在 C:\Program Files\eclipse\Flex Builder,2. 指定 Eclipse 安装路径为 C:\Program Files\eclipse3. 选择是否安装浏览器 Flash Plyer 9 插件(可选安装 阅读全文
posted @ 2012-01-04 13:02 星^_^風 阅读(230) 评论(0) 推荐(0) 编辑
  2011年12月19日
摘要: 对于Java程序员来说,工作中经常会遇到这样一些问题,比如引用了些第三方提供的非开源jar包,这个时候我们需要用它,甚至需要改它的内容。怎么办?下面看看开发中会遇到哪些问题?某个类的里面的字段默认值不符合需求要改掉.某个方法里面有很多校验,想直接return ;绕过校验。某个方法里面的计算方法太复杂,想用自己的计算方式。替换方法体。首先声明一点,如果是收费的,切勿参加商业性质。 往往这个时候我们就会很棘手,因为确实不好操作,不好处理。现在我给大家介绍两种方式,解决一些比较常见且简单的问题。1、 反编译class文件,推荐Java Decompiler 这个工具几乎能正确的反编译出源代码... 阅读全文
posted @ 2011-12-19 15:46 星^_^風 阅读(910) 评论(0) 推荐(0) 编辑
  2011年11月24日
摘要: public static String getChineseCharacter(long seed) throws Exception{String str = null;//保存结果int highPos,lowPOs; //高位、低位Random random = new Random(seed); //随机数生成器highPos = 176 + Math.abs(random.nextInt(39)); //计算高位数lowPos = 161 + Math.abs(random.nextInt(93)); //计算低位数byte[] b = new byte[2]; //转化为B类型b 阅读全文
posted @ 2011-11-24 22:34 星^_^風 阅读(416) 评论(0) 推荐(0) 编辑
摘要: public class RandomNumber{public static void main(String[] args) {// 使用java.lang.Math的random方法生成随机数System.out.println("Math.random(): " + Math.random());// 使用不带参数的构造方法构造java.util.Random对象System.out.println("使用不带参数的构造方法构造的Random对象:");Random rd1 = new Random();// 产生各种类型的随机数// 按均匀分布 阅读全文
posted @ 2011-11-24 22:18 星^_^風 阅读(873) 评论(0) 推荐(0) 编辑
  2011年11月23日
摘要: (1)简介:在过去几年里,Hibernate不断发展,几乎成为Java数据库持久性的事实标准。它非常强大、灵活,而且具备了优异的性能。在本文中,我们将了解如何使用Java 5 注释来简化Hibernate代码,并使持久层的编码过程变得更为轻松。 传统上,Hibernate的配置依赖于外部 XML 文件:数据库映射被定义为一组 XML 映射文件,并且在启动时进行加载。 在最近发布的几个Hibernate版本中,出现了一种基于 Java 5 注释的更为巧妙的新方法。借助新的 Hibernate Annotation 库,即可一次性地分配所有旧映射文件——一切都会按照您的想法来定义——注释直接嵌入. 阅读全文
posted @ 2011-11-23 21:49 星^_^風 阅读(319) 评论(0) 推荐(0) 编辑
  2011年11月20日
摘要: 1.java.util.Calendar Calendar 类是一个抽象类,它为特定瞬间与一组诸如 YEAR、MONTH、DAY_OF_MONTH、HOUR 等 日历字段之间的转换提供了一些方法,并为操作日历字段(例如获得下星期的日期)提供了一些方法。瞬间可用毫秒值来表示,它是距历元(即格林威治标准时间 1970 年 1 月 1 日的 00:00:00.000,格里高利历)的偏移量。例: Java代码 1. Calendar cal = Calendar.getInstance();//使用默认时区和语言环境获得一个日历。 2. cal.add(Calendar.DAY_OF_MONTH, . 阅读全文
posted @ 2011-11-20 23:27 星^_^風 阅读(230) 评论(0) 推荐(0) 编辑
  2011年10月20日
摘要: Java不是完美的,Java的不足除了体现在运行速度上要比传统的C++慢许多之外,Java无法直接访问到操作系统底层(如系统硬件等),为此Java使用native方法来扩展Java程序的功能。 可以将native方法比作Java程序同C程序的接口,其实现步骤: 1、在Java中声明native()方法,然后编译; 2、用javah产生一个.h文件; 3、写一个.cpp文件实现native导出方法,其中需要包含第二步产生的.h文件(注意其中又包含了JDK带的jni.h文件); 4、将第三步的.cpp文件编译成动态链接库文件; 5、在Java中用System.loadLibrary()... 阅读全文
posted @ 2011-10-20 11:23 星^_^風 阅读(179) 评论(0) 推荐(0) 编辑
  2011年10月15日
摘要: 在interface里面的变量默认都是public static final 的。所以可以直接省略修饰符:String param="ssm";//变量需要初始化 为什么接口要规定成员变量必须是public static final的呢? 答: 首先接口是一种高度抽象的"模版",,而接口中的属性也就是’模版’的成员,就应当是所有实现"模版"的实现类的共有特性,所以它是public static的 ,是所有实现类共有的 .假如可以是非static的话,因一个类可以继承多个接口,出现重名的变量,如何区分呢?其次,接口中如果可能定义非fin 阅读全文
posted @ 2011-10-15 12:18 星^_^風 阅读(271) 评论(0) 推荐(0) 编辑
上一页 1 ··· 10 11 12 13 14 15 16 17 18 ··· 20 下一页